Application

The Rapid Bee Feeder is a versatile and essential tool designed to cater to both 8-frame and 10-frame bee hives, making it a perfect fit for a wide range of beekeeping setups. With a capacity of up to 2 liters of syrup, this feeder ensures that your bees have a reliable and consistent food source, which is crucial for their health and productivity. The feeder's design is particularly beneficial for beekeepers who manage multiple hives, as it can be easily adapted to different hive sizes without the need for additional modifications.

One of the standout features of the Rapid Bee Feeder is its compatibility with the more compact 8-frame hive box. This design is not only optimal for the comfort of honey bees, especially during the winter months, but also provides a cozier, better-insulated home for the bees’ cluster. The compact nature of the 8-frame hive makes it easier for the cluster to reach its honey storage, ensuring that the bees have access to food even in colder weather. Additionally, the 8-frame hive is better suited for the natural instincts and building methods of honey bees, resembling the tall, narrow hives that wild honeybees create.

The Rapid Bee Feeder is also designed with ease of use in mind. Placing the feeder in the hole of an inner cover and covering the middle cone with the clear inside cup helps to keep the bees from escaping or possibly drowning in the sugar water. This setup is not only simple but also effective in ensuring that the bees can feed without any disturbances. The feeder's design allows for easy filling without the need to disturb the hive, making it a convenient option for beekeepers who want to minimize their impact on the bees.

Feature

The Rapid Bee Feeder boasts several innovative features that set it apart from traditional feeders. One of the key features is the textured cup and cone design. The feeder has textures on both the inner cup and the feeding cone, which allow bees to grip firmly and reduce the risk of drowning while feeding. This thoughtful design ensures that the bees can feed safely and efficiently, without the risk of getting stuck or drowning in the syrup.

Another notable feature is the transparent inner cup, which not only prevents bees from flying around but also allows beekeepers to view the bees while they are feeding. This transparency provides a unique opportunity to observe the bees' behavior and ensure that they are feeding properly. The clear inner cup also helps to guide bees to quickly find the water source, making the feeding process more efficient.

The feeder's design also includes a practical solution for preventing bees from falling into the syrup. By cutting the top off a small sock and fitting it down over the cone of the feeder, beekeepers can further reduce the risk of drowning. This simple yet effective modification adds an extra layer of safety for the bees, ensuring that they can feed without any issues.

FAQ

What Are The Main Applications Of Beekeeping Tools?

Beekeeping tools are primarily used for tasks such as opening bee hives, removing and replacing frames, and performing maintenance on hive surfaces. They are essential for beekeeping activities aimed at pollination, honey production, and hive management.

What Types Of Beekeeping Tools Are Available?

Beekeeping tools include protective gear like gloves, hats with veils, and suits; hive management tools such as hive tools, frame lifters, and grafting tools; and specialized equipment like bee venom collectors and honey uncapping knives.

What Features Should Good Beekeeping Gloves Have?

Good beekeeping gloves should be made of durable materials like goatskin leather for protection against bee stings and heat resistance. They should be flexible enough to work between frames and ideally extend up to the elbow with a cinched end to keep bees out.

What Are The Advantages Of Using Beekeeping Tools?

Beekeeping tools offer numerous benefits, including enhanced safety for beekeepers, efficient hive management, and improved productivity in tasks like honey extraction and queen rearing. They also contribute to the overall health and maintenance of bee colonies.

How Do Beekeeping Tools Contribute To Beekeeping As A Practice?

Beekeeping tools play a crucial role in making beekeeping a rewarding and sustainable practice. They help in maintaining healthy bee colonies, ensuring safe and efficient hive management, and supporting activities that benefit biodiversity, food production, and global ecosystems.

What Are Some Examples Of Protective Beekeeping Gear?

Protective beekeeping gear includes items like goatskin leather gloves, beekeeping suits with hats and veils, ventilated helmets, and jackets designed to offer maximum protection against bee stings while ensuring comfort and breathability.

What Is The Purpose Of Hive Tools In Beekeeping?

Hive tools are used for opening bee hives, removing and replacing frames, scraping wax, and prying hive boxes. They are essential for routine hive inspections and maintenance, ensuring the smooth operation of beekeeping activities.

What Are The Benefits Of Using Stainless Steel Beekeeping Tools?

Stainless steel beekeeping tools are durable, rust-resistant, and easy to clean, making them ideal for tasks like hive inspections, frame cleaning, and honey extraction. Their ergonomic design ensures efficient and safe handling during beekeeping operations.

How Do Beekeeping Tools Support Queen Rearing?

Beekeeping tools like grafting tools and queen cages are essential for queen rearing. They enable precise handling of larvae, safe transport of queen bees, and efficient grafting processes, which are crucial for maintaining and expanding bee colonies.

What Is The Significance Of Beekeeping In Environmental Conservation?

Beekeeping supports environmental conservation by promoting biodiversity, enhancing pollination of plants, and contributing to the health of ecosystems. It also aids in the production of natural products like honey and beeswax, which have various uses and benefits.
